public void Set(VisitBL visit) { txtId.Text = visit.Id.ToString(); txtDate.Text = visit.Date.ToString("dd/MM/yyyy"); txtDiagnosis.Text = visit.Diagnosis; txtFIO.Text = visit.Patient.FIO; txtType.Text = visit.VisitType.Name; _ChoosePatient = visit.Patient; _ChooseVisitType = visit.VisitType; }
private VisitBL Get() { VisitBL visit = new VisitBL() { Id = string.IsNullOrEmpty(txtId.Text) ? Guid.Empty : new Guid(txtId.Text), Date = Convert.ToDateTime(txtDate.Text), Diagnosis = txtDiagnosis.Text, Patient = _ChoosePatient, VisitType = _ChooseVisitType }; return(visit); }
private void btDelete_Click(object sender, RoutedEventArgs e) { if (lvVisits.SelectedItem == null) { MessageBox.Show("Выберите пациента"); return; } VisitBL visit = (VisitBL)lvVisits.SelectedItem; string res = visit.Delete(); if (!string.IsNullOrEmpty(res)) { MessageBox.Show(res); } Refresh(); }
void Refresh() { lvVisits.ItemsSource = VisitBL.GetAll(); }